Last night I was paying D&D (5e), and this was the first combat encounter our party has had since I've been playing this character. I'm a Wizard, so I do the spell stuff. Long story short, I cast Web and made a 20'*20'(*20') area sticky. (It was pretty pivotal, thank you.)

We didn't have a handy solution, so we marked as many empty spaces as we could with tiny d6's. I am certain there's a better way.

How do you mark your persistent spell effects on your game boards/maps?

(I'm considering printing out a 4"*4" square--which would represent the 20'*20' in D*D--but that's specific to just one spell. Also I have to do my best to art it up which will turn out poorly. And it'd be specific to just Web. Any less specific or more readily available options?)
